As a Business Analyst you’re a facilitator, investigator and fact checker; finding gaps and working closely with the Product Manager and Product Owner to determine scope and requirements and ultimately, ensuring the resulting product is fit-for-purpose.
With your design/solution experience, you ensure the right questions are asked and advise/support on requirements analysis, minimum viable product, user stories, and prioritisation to bring more value to our end users.

We’re looking for an experienced Core Platform Business Analyst with a can-do attitude and curiosity for learning. You’re a humble achiever that gets things done, collaborates well and demonstrates ownership. You love digging into problems, take in lots of information and quickly make sense of it, to ensure that we have what’s needed to deliver the right solutions.

Reporting to the Product Manager you will be working closely with our Core Product domain as well as with key stakeholders within Lottoland, plus third-party providers. You will contribute to the core roadmap, interpret and generate detailed product requirements, create customer journey models for key user flows (e.g., registration), support the team throughout implementation and sign off process, support operational and commercial teams post the launch. Your main goal is to allow our international customers to enjoy Lottoland’s products by providing a seamless user experience across registration, KYC, compliance/safer gambling requirements and login.

Your focus is more tactical and detail-oriented; the Product Managers support you on the high level and strategic parts and the Product Owners liaise directly with the development teams to make your requirements become a reality. You have a solid technical understanding, and we can count on you to ensure nothing important is missed.

With you on the team, we can be sure that we have the right requirements and deliver a product that it is fit-for-purpose and delivers value, quickly. It’s about continuous improvement not delayed perfection.

Responsibilities
  • Create and document detailed requirements from liaising with different stakeholders including UX, Architecture, Delivery to ensure development without delays due to missing information or artefacts
  • Collaborate with the Product Owner on writing and/or reviewing user stories and clarification of the business requirements when needed
  • Partner with the PO to guide the dev team; communicate the product vision and help the team understand the requirements, flow, complexity, and dependencies.
  • Work with stakeholders where required to review the software as it develops e.g. walkthroughs and other testing activities, ensuring that the project meets all the specified requirements.
  • Contribute to domain success by building strong bond between business and development team, empowering development team by setting business context
  • Assist with go live preparations e.g. organizing the testing with internal/external resources, assuring efficient communication between providers and the development team
  • Document new product features and write user manuals
  • Collaborate with data analysists to assess impact of a problem and measure delivered solution success
  • Maintain professional and technical knowledge by attending educational workshops; reviewing professional publications; establishing personal networks etc.
  • Ensure deliveries are fit-for-purpose and ready-to-use (including troubleshooting guides, rollout plans and dependencies management)
